What’s one of the main differences due to the impact of imperialism in china?

Answers

What’s one of the main differences due to the impact of imperialism in china?

One of the main differences due to the impact of imperialism in China was the loss of political and economic sovereignty. Imperialism in China, which began in the mid-19th century, was characterized by the invasion, colonization, and exploitation of Chinese territories by foreign powers, particularly European powers and Japan. This resulted in the forced opening of China to international trade, the signing of unequal treaties that favored foreign powers, and the establishment of foreign concessions in China's major cities.

As a result of imperialism, China lost its political and economic independence, and was forced to cede territory, pay indemnities, and grant extraterritorial rights to foreign powers. Additionally, foreign powers gained control of key industries, such as mining and transportation, which further eroded China's economic sovereignty. Imperialism in China also contributed to social and cultural changes, including the spread of Christianity and Western education, and the growth of nationalism and anti-imperialist movements.

Possibly the most notable military conflict in history named after an automaker was what War fought in 1987, during which Chadian forces used outfitted HiLuxes and Land Cruisers to mobilize troops and expel Libyan occupiers?

Answers

The conflict being referred to is the "Toyota War," also known as the "Chadian-Libyan Conflict," which took place in 1987. The conflict involved Chadian forces fighting against Libyan troops who had occupied parts of Chad.

The Chadian forces, led by General Idriss Déby, were vastly outnumbered and outgunned by the Libyan army. However, they gained an advantage by using Toyota vehicles, specifically HiLuxes and Land Cruisers, which were outfitted with heavy weaponry and used to mobilize troops quickly.

The Chadian forces were able to take the Libyans by surprise, and despite suffering heavy losses, they were eventually able to drive them out of Chad.

The conflict was named after Toyota because of the pivotal role that Toyota vehicles played in the battle. Using these vehicles in war has since become a notable example of the importance of logistics and mobility in military operations.

the seven year war was fought from 1756–1763, involved nearly all of europe, and included colonial battles on three continents. what was the name given to the north american phase of the war?

Answers

The names given to the North American phase of the Seven Years' War were the French and Indian War.

The French and Indian War was a significant part of the larger Seven Years' War, which involved many European powers and had global implications. The war was fought primarily between Great Britain and France, with their respective colonial forces battling for control of North America. The conflict began in 1754 when British forces clashed with French soldiers and their Native American allies in the Ohio River Valley. The fighting continued for several years, with both sides winning major victories and suffering significant losses. In the end, Britain emerged victorious, and France was forced to cede its North American colonies to the British.

The French and Indian War was a crucial turning point in American history, as it set the stage for the American Revolution and the eventual formation of the United States.

Introduction
THE IMPACT OF PSEUDOSCIENTIFIC IDEAS 1933

Answers

Answer:

The year 1933 marked a turning point in history, as Adolf Hitler and the Nazi Party rose to power in Germany. This period is often referred to as the Third Reich, and it was characterized by a number of ideologies and beliefs that were based on pseudoscientific ideas. These ideas were used to justify the Nazi's policies, including their persecution of Jews and other minority groups.

One of the most well-known pseudoscientific ideas of the Third Reich was the concept of "racial purity". This idea held that certain races, particularly the so-called "Aryan" race, were superior to others and that it was necessary to preserve this purity through eugenics, or selective breeding. The Nazis used this idea to justify their persecution of Jews, Romani people, and other minority groups, as they believed that these groups were a threat to the racial purity of the German people.

Another pseudoscientific idea that gained popularity in the Third Reich was the concept of "scientific racism". This idea held that race was not only a biological characteristic but also determined a person's intellect, personality, and behavior. The Nazis used this idea to justify their belief in the superiority of the Aryan race and their persecution of other races and ethnicities.

The impact of these pseudoscientific ideas was far-reaching and devastating. They were used to justify the systematic murder of millions of people during the Holocaust, as well as other atrocities committed by the Nazi regime. Even after the fall of the Third Reich, these ideas continued to influence people and societies around the world, highlighting the dangerous power of pseudoscience and the importance of critical thinking and scientific rigor in society.

Which statement is true of African American troops during the Civil War?

A. They were treated equally with white troops.

B. They were very few in number.

C. They fought on the Union side in large numbers.

D. They served in non-combat support roles only.

Answers

African American troops fought on the Union side in large numbers during the Civil War. Option C is the correct statement.

African American troops played a significant role in the Union army during the Civil War. Initially, African Americans were not allowed to enlist in the Union army, but as the war progressed, Lincoln signed the Emancipation Proclamation which allowed African Americans to join the army.

By the end of the war, approximately 180,000 African Americans had served in the Union army and navy, comprising about 10% of the total Union forces. Despite facing discrimination and unequal treatment, African American troops made valuable contributions to the Union war effort and helped to secure the eventual victory.

what aspect of early nineteenth-century american government had the founders condemned as contrary to republican ideals

Answers

Aspect of early nineteenth-century American government had the founders condemned as contrary to republican ideals was the emergence of political parties.

Political divisions or parties began to arise during the attempt to ratify the federal Constitution in 1787. Tensions between them developed as the focus shifted from the construction of a new federal government to the question of how powerful that federal government would be. The Federalists, led by Treasury Secretary Alexander Hamilton, advocated for centralised power, whilst the Anti-Federalists, led by Secretary of State Thomas Jefferson, advocated for state rights rather than centralised rule.

Federalists rallied behind the country's economic sector, while opponents found support among those who favoured an agrarian society. In his Farewell Address as President of the United States, George Washington warned of "the baneful effects of the spirit of party" following the partisan warfare.

French and Indian War: The most prominent British leader during the war was William Pitt, (later the Earl of Chatham) who was the Secretary of State for the Southern Department for much of the conflict. Pitt served in this position in a coalition government with which British statesman, who held the office of Prime Minister?

Answers

During the French and Indian War, William Pitt was indeed the most prominent British leader. As the Secretary of State for the Southern Department, he played a significant role in the conflict. Pitt served in this position as part of a coalition government led by Thomas Pelham-Holles, the Duke of Newcastle. Newcastle was the Prime Minister during much of the war, and he and Pitt had a complicated relationship. However, they could work together effectively to lead Britain to victory.

Pitt was responsible for many of the military and strategic decisions that helped turn the tide of the war, including the decision to focus on the North American theatre of operations. His leadership and determination were essential in securing victory for Britain. After the war, Pitt was hailed as a hero and would eventually become Prime Minister.

Answers

Answer:

The Holocaust, also known as the Shoah, was a genocide in which Nazi Germany, led by Adolf Hitler and the Nazi Party, systematically murdered approximately six million Jews, along with millions of other minority groups, including Romani people, people with disabilities, LGBTQ+ individuals, and others who were deemed undesirable by the Nazis.

The Holocaust took place during World War II, from 1939 to 1945, and was carried out across German-occupied territories, as well as in concentration and extermination camps. The Nazis used methods such as forced labor, starvation, medical experimentation, and gas chambers to execute their victims.

The Holocaust is considered one of the greatest tragedies of the 20th century, not only because of the massive loss of life, but also because of the impact it had on the world. It changed the course of history, led to the creation of the state of Israel, and forever altered the way people think about human rights and the consequences of unchecked power.

Today, the Holocaust serves as a reminder of the atrocities that can be committed by those in power, and the importance of speaking out against hate, bigotry, and prejudice in all its forms.
